Chattanooga firefighters from eight companies needed 45 minutes to get a commercial fire near Amnicola Highway under control Thursday night, spokesman Bruce Garner said in a release Friday.

The fire started about 9 p.m. at Zeco Inc., 4146 South Creek Road. The building was closed for the day and no one was there when the blaze started, Garner said. No one was injured.

The first firefighters arrived to find the entire back of the building engulfed in flames. The firefighters cut through a chain-link fence to get close to the building and started to spray water onto the roof of the building, Garner said.

Firefighters then used a metal-cutting power saw to get into the building and used hoses to attack the fire from inside.

The cause of the fire is under investigation, and the estimated cost of the damage has not been determined.
